🔥 PHP大神必看!如何轻松搞定文件上传?🚀,想让网页秒变文件库?PHP文件上传功能来帮忙!这篇文章将带你走进PHP世界,解锁文件上传的神秘面纱,无论是初学者还是进阶开发者,都能收获满满干货!👨💻👩💻
首先,文件上传是通过HTTP协议中的`POST`方法完成的。PHP作为后端,监听着服务器,等待浏览器发送请求。想象一下,你把文件像快递一样寄出,PHP是那个拆包裹的邮差!👨📦
创建一个HTML表单,添加`enctype="multipart/form-data"`,这是告诉浏览器我们要上传文件。然后,用`$_FILES`数组在PHP里迎接你的文件朋友。就像这样: `{$_FILES[ file ][ name ]}`,名字就看你给它取什么了!📝🖼️
别忘了检查文件类型、大小和路径,确保安全。`move_uploaded_file()`函数是你的得力助手,它能帮你把文件从临时目录移到指定位置,避免恶意文件入侵!🛡️🛡️
遇到问题?别怕,PHP的错误处理机制能帮到你。`error_reporting()`和`ini_set()`可以定制错误报告,同时记得记录每一次操作,方便排查问题。🔍🔍
为了性能和用户体验,考虑使用`upload_max_filesize`和`post_max_size`设置上传限制。另外,异步上传或使用CDN分发可以进一步提升效率。🚀💨
现在,你已经掌握了PHP文件上传的精髓。记住,每一次点击上传都是用户对你的信任,用心对待,你的网站将更加可靠!💖👨🏫👩🏫